Highlights
Are people in Miamisburg older or younger than people in Mason?
- The Median Age in Miamisburg is 2.1 years younger than in Mason.

Are housing costs cheaper in Miamisburg or Mason?
- Miamisburg housing costs are 45.5% less expensive than Mason hous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Miamisburg or Mason?
- The average commute for residents of Miamisburg is 4.0 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Mason.

Things to do in Mason?
Mason, OH lies just north of Cincinnati within Warren County boasting several public parks ideal for outdoor fun combined with excellent amenities like a great variety of shops and restaurants.

Things to do in Miamisburg?
Miamisburg, OH is an inviting town south of Dayton full of wonderful places to explore like Mound Park presenting tranquil grounds and gardens or Riverfront Park hosting outdoor activities; their annual event Miamisburg Spring Fest brings people together with food and games every April.
